Linux下RAR文件解压缩命令全解析与实用技巧分享
在Linux系统中,文件的压缩与解压缩是日常操作中常见的需求。RAR格式作为一种广泛使用的压缩文件格式,在Windows系统中大家可能比较熟悉,但在Linux系统中对其进行解压缩操作可能对于一些新手来说略显陌生。不过,借助相应的工具和命令,在Linux系统中实现RAR文件的解压缩并不复杂。
在Linux系统里,要对RAR文件进行解压缩,我们首先需要安装相应的工具。一般而言,我们会使用`unrar`这个工具。不同的Linux发行版安装`unrar`的方式可能略有不同。对于基于Debian或Ubuntu的系统,我们可以使用`apt`包管理器来安装,在终端中输入如下命令:`sudo apt-get install unrar`,按下回车键后,系统会自动从软件源中下载并安装`unrar`工具。而对于基于Red Hat或CentOS的系统,则可以使用`yum`或`dnf`来安装,例如使用`dnf`时,命令为`dnf install unrar`。
安装好`unrar`工具后,我们就可以开始进行RAR文件的解压缩操作了。最基本的解压缩命令是`unrar x`。假设我们有一个名为`example.rar`的RAR文件,想要将其解压到当前目录下,可以在终端中输入`unrar x example.rar`,然后按下回车键。执行该命令后,`unrar`会将`example.rar`文件中的所有内容解压到当前目录。如果想要将文件解压到指定的目录,比如解压到`/home/user/extracted`目录下,那么命令可以写成`unrar x example.rar /home/user/extracted`。
除了`unrar x`命令,还有`unrar e`命令。`unrar e`命令和`unrar x`命令的区别在于,`unrar e`只是简单地将RAR文件中的内容提取到指定目录,不会保留原有的目录结构,而`unrar x`会完整地保留原有的目录结构。例如,RAR文件中包含`folder/file.txt`这样的文件结构,使用`unrar e`解压后,`file.txt`会直接出现在指定的解压目录下,而使用`unrar x`解压后,会在指定目录下创建`folder`目录,并将`file.txt`文件放在`folder`目录中。
在解压缩过程中,还可能会遇到一些特殊情况。比如RAR文件设置了密码,这时在解压缩时就需要输入密码。当执行`unrar x`或`unrar e`命令后,如果文件有密码,`unrar`会提示输入密码,我们只需按照提示输入正确的密码,然后按下回车键即可继续完成解压缩操作。
如果RAR文件比较大,解压缩过程可能会比较耗时。在这种情况下,我们可以通过一些参数来查看解压缩的进度。例如,使用`-v`参数可以显示详细的解压缩信息,让我们实时了解解压缩的进度。命令可以写成`unrar x -v example.rar`。
除了解压缩,`unrar`工具还具备其他一些功能。例如,我们可以使用`unrar l`命令来查看RAR文件的内容列表,而不需要进行实际的解压缩操作。输入`unrar l example.rar`,终端会列出`example.rar`文件中包含的所有文件和目录的信息,包括文件名、大小、修改日期等。
在Linux系统中熟练掌握RAR文件的解压缩命令,对于我们日常的文件管理和使用非常有帮助。无论是处理工作中的文档资料,还是下载的软件资源,都可以通过这些命令快速、方便地完成解压缩操作,提高我们的工作效率。了解这些命令的不同用法和参数,也能让我们在面对各种复杂情况时更加从容应对,充分发挥Linux系统的强大功能。